BIM et Intelligence Artificielle à l’ère des drones et des engins de construction autonomes : Une progression révolutionnaire propulsée par le langage C++
Dans le domaine de la construction, l’évolution des technologies est en constante accélération. Parmi les progrès les plus impressionnants, on trouve la combinaison du Building Information Modeling (BIM) avec l’Intelligence Artificielle (IA), ainsi que l’émergence des drones et des engins de construction autonomes. Ces avancées révolutionnaires ont le potentiel de transformer l’industrie de la construction, en augmentant l’efficacité, la précision et la sécurité des projets. Et au cœur de cette révolution se trouve le langage de programmation C++.
Le BIM est un processus qui permet de créer et de gérer des informations virtuelles et intelligentes sur un bâtiment, tout au long de son cycle de vie. Il permet de modéliser numériquement les différentes phases de construction, de la conception à la maintenance, en passant par la construction. Le BIM offre de nombreux avantages, tels que la prévention des erreurs de conception, la collaboration efficace entre les différentes parties prenantes et la gestion optimisée du projet. Cependant, pour tirer pleinement parti des avantages du BIM, il est nécessaire d’utiliser des outils d’IA.
L’IA est capable d’analyser de grandes quantités de données BIM et de générer des informations précieuses pour les concepteurs, les ingénieurs et les architectes. Grâce à des algorithmes sophistiqués, l’IA peut identifier les zones de conflit potentielles, optimiser la gestion de l’énergie, estimer les coûts de construction et bien plus encore. L’utilisation de l’IA dans le processus BIM permet d’automatiser certaines tâches, d’économiser du temps et de réduire les erreurs humaines.
Pour ajouter une couche supplémentaire de révolution technologique, les drones et les engins de construction autonomes font leur apparition sur les chantiers. Les drones peuvent être utilisés pour la surveillance des chantiers, l’inspection des structures et la collecte de données géospatiales. Les engins de construction autonomes, quant à eux, peuvent réaliser des tâches de manière autonome, en utilisant des algorithmes basés sur l’IA pour naviguer sur le chantier de manière sécurisée et efficace.
C’est là qu’intervient le langage C++. En tant que langage de programmation extrêmement puissant et polyvalent, le C++ est le choix idéal pour développer des applications de pointe dans le domaine du BIM, de l’IA, des drones et des engins de construction autonomes. Le C++ offre une grande flexibilité, des performances élevées, une gestion efficace de la mémoire et une compatibilité avec d’autres langages de programmation. Il est utilisé dans de nombreux logiciels de modélisation BIM, ainsi que dans le développement d’algorithmes d’IA et de logiciels embarqués pour les drones et les engins de construction autonomes.
En conclusion, l’association du BIM et de l’IA avec l’utilisation croissante des drones et des engins de construction autonomes ouvre de nouvelles perspectives dans l’industrie de la construction. Cette progression révolutionnaire permet d’améliorer l’efficacité, la précision et la sécurité des projets. Et au cœur de cette révolution se trouve le langage C++, qui offre les outils nécessaires pour développer des applications innovantes dans ce domaine en constante évolution. Les professionnels de la construction doivent donc se familiariser avec les concepts du BIM et de l’IA, ainsi qu’avec la programmation en C++, afin de rester à la pointe de l’innovation dans le secteur du bâtiment.